Recently I did stumble across some more information(before CTXS seemed to shut down info) on Vertigo while getting ready to throw out their 1998 annual report. Within the report, they weren't so secretive about Vertigo because it was a recent acquisition and they wanted to explain it. Here's what they say verbatim:

"APM Purchase- The in-process research and development acquired in the APM acquisition consisted primarily of one significant reseacrh and development porject. The project is a Windows NT-based application server for Java, which is similar to WinFrame software, but actually runs Java applications. At the date of the acquisition, APM was shipping a secure server-based enterprise solution that helped companies deploy and manage intranet and Internet-based Java appliations. The company esimtates this project was less than 47% complete at the date of acquisition."

As you may recall, Ray pointed out upstream that Vertigo is the code name given by Citrix for the above project.
